b’s mixed bag

August 17, 2005

News Aggregator / Syndication / RSS|Atom Feeds : เมื่อเกิดอาการ blog overload

Filed under: b explains

เดี๋ยวนี้หันไปทางไหน ใครๆก็มีบล็อก (blog - ย่อมาจาก weBLOG หรือ web log นั่นเอง) กันหมด ไม่เฉพาะแหล่งข่าวสาระต่างๆ แม้แต่พี่ ป้า น้า อา เพื่อนฝูง เดี๋ยวนี้ก็มีบล็อกส่วนตัวกันทั้งนั้น นับๆไปแล้ว จำนวนบล็อกที่จะอ่านประจำวันชักจะเกินจำนวนนิ้วที่มี (ทั้งมือ ทั้งเท้า เอิ๊กๆ) ครั้นจะตามไปเช็คทุกบล็อกทุกวันก็ดูจะเป็นกิจกรรมที่ไม่ “เพื่อความบันเทิง” ต่อไปเสียแล้ว ซึ่งก็เป็นเหตุให้บุกมาเขียนเล่าสู่กันฟังวันนี้ล่ะค่ะ .. ทำอย่างไรเราถึงจะเช็คบล็อกหลายๆบล็อกพร้อมๆกันได้ง่ายๆบ้าง? ไม่ยากค่ะ ถ้าเรารู้จักใช้ประโยชน์จาก Syndication / RSS|Atom feeds

เจ้า RSS|Atom Feeds หรือ Syndication นี่.. หลายๆคนอาจจะผ่านตากับมันมาบ้างแล้วตามเว็บต่างๆ ถ้าสังเกตดูจะเห็นว่า เดี๋ยวนี้หลายๆเว็บ (ส่วนมากเว็บฝรั่ง) จะมีไอค่อน “RSS” “Atom” หรือ “XML” แอบๆอยู่ในหน้าเว็บ อย่างในรูปข้างล่างนี่..

หลากหลายรูปแบบของ news syndication

เว็บไหนที่มีเครื่องหมายเหล่านี้นี่แหละค่ะ คือเว็บที่มี Syndication หรือ Feeds ให้เรา “สมัครรับ” บทความได้ คือแทนที่เราจะต้องแวะไปเช็คตามเว็บต่างๆ ก็ใช้ลงโปรแกรมสำหรับอ่านข่าว (News Aggregator หรือใช้บริการทางเว็บ .. ซึ่งจะพูดถึงเป็นอันดับต่อไป) แล้วก็ “สมัคร” รับ Feeds ต่างๆ จากนั้นโปรแกรมก็เป็นตัวไปเช็คแต่ละบล็อก/เว็บให้เราเองอัตโนมัติ แล้วนำมาแสดงรวมกันในที่เดียว ซึ่งทำให้ง่ายต่อการเช็ค update ของหลายเว็บพร้อมๆกัน โดยเฉพาะถ้าเราอ่านบล็อก/เว็บข่าวสารมากกว่า 5 เว็บขึ้นไปนี่ .. สะดวกมากๆเลยค่ะ

มาถึงตรงนี้แล้ว เริ่มอยากลองใช้งาน news feeds กันขึ้นมาบ้างหรือยังคะ? :) ถ้าสนใจจะทดลองใช้กันขึ้นมาบ้างแล้วก็อ่านต่อกันเลยค่ะ บุกจะแนะนำโปรแกรมและวิธีใช้จากประสบการณ์ให้ฟัง

ก่อนอื่น ต้องขอออกตัวก่อนนะคะว่า ที่จะเขียนต่อไปนี้ มาจากประสบการณ์ใช้งานของบุกเอง ซึ่งอาจจะไม่ใช่วิธีที่ดีที่สุด หรือโปรแกรมที่เลือกมานำเสนออาจจะไม่ใช่ตัวที่ใช้งานง่ายสุด แต่เป็นอันที่บุกใช้แล้วชอบเท่านั้น ที่นำมาเสนอก็เพื่อเป็นแนวทางสำหรับเพื่อนๆ ที่ต่อไปสามารถนำไปทดลองใช้กับโปรแกรมหรือบริการอื่นๆได้ เพราะหลักการหลักๆแล้วมันก็อย่างเดียวกันน่ะค่ะ

เอาล่ะค่ะ เริ่มเลยละกัน

โปรแกรมที่บุกใช้ในการอ่าน News feeds ที่จะนำมาเป็นตัวอย่างนี่มีชื่อว่า Mozilla Thunderbird เป็นโปรแกรมที่โหลดมาใช้ได้ฟรี และมีให้ใช้บนหลากหลาย platform ไม่ว่าจะเป็นพีซี, แม็ค, หรืออื่นๆ จริงแล้วโปรแกรมนี้ไว้สำหรับอีเมล์ แต่ว่ามันสามารถใช้สำหรับอ่านข่าวได้ด้วย (ทั้ง feeds และ usenet newsgroups) 2 หรือ 3-in-1 แบบนี้บุกชอบค่ะ ไม่ต้องเปิดไว้หลายๆโปรแกรมให้เปลืองซอส ;) นอกจากนี้แล้ว Thunderbird เป็นโปรแกรมที่เราสามารถ “พกพา (portable)” ได้ คือหากเรามี USB flash drive สักอัน ก็สามารถโหลด Thunderbird ฉบับ Portable มาลงในเจ้า USB drive นี่ แล้วพกพาไปใช้กับคอมเครื่องอื่นๆได้ด้วย

แหม่ โคดจะสะนาเยอะ อย่างกับได้ค่าคอมฯก็มิปาน :P เอาเป็นว่าไปโหลดมาลงกันให้เรียบร้อยก่อนจะต่อไปขั้นต่อไปละกันนะคะ ฮ่าๆ หลังจากลงโปรแกรมเรียบร้อยแล้ว วิธีการตั้งค่าให้โปรแกรมรับข่าวสารจากเว็บต่างๆก็ไม่ยากเลยค่ะ

1. ขั้นแรกก็ไปที่เมนู Tools แล้วเลือก Account Settings

Tools - Account Settings

จากนั้นก็กดปุ่ม “Add account…” ที่อยู่ทางด้านล่างซ้ายของหน้าต่างค่ะ (ปุ่มบนสุดในสามปุ่ม)

2. เมื่อหน้าต่างสำหรับตั้ง account ใหม่ขึ้นมา ก็เลือก “Rss News & Blogs” แล้วก็กดปุ่ม next

Account Wizard - New Account Setup

3. ทีนี้โปรแกรมก็จะให้เราตั้งชื่อ account สำหรับข่าวและบล็อก ก็ตั้งชื่ออะไรก็ได้ตามแต่ใจชอบเลยค่ะ ในตัวอย่างนี้จะตั้งว่า “News & Blogs” นะคะ

Account Name

หลังจากกด next แล้วมันก็จะขึ้นหน้าจอนี้ขึ้นมาค่ะ

Account Wizard - Finished

เราก็กด Finish เพื่อเป็นการยืนยันว่าทุกอย่างถูกต้อง เป็นอันเสร็จไปครึ่งนึงแล้วค่ะ เห็นไหม บอกแล้วว่าง่ายนิดเดียว :)

4. กลับมาที่หน้า Account Settings นะคะ

จะเห็นว่าทางด้านซ้ายมือมี “News & Blogs” ขึ้นมาให้แล้วตอนนี้ (ภาพนี้จับมาจากโปรแกรมที่บุกใช้งาน เลยมีว่างๆสีขาวข้างบน .. เนื่องจากบุกเซ็นเซอร์ข้อมูลส่วนตัวออกน่ะค่ะ) ถ้าโปรแกรมไม่ได้เลือก (highlight) ตรง “News & Blogs” ก็เลือกมันเสียนะคะ ทีนี้ทางด้านขวามือก็จะขึ้นมาให้เราตั้งค่าอย่างในรูปค่ะ

RSS Account Settings

  • Check for new articles every … minutes : ติ๊กเลือกเพื่อให้โปรแกรมเช็คเว็บสำหรับข่าวหรือบทความใหม่ๆทุกๆกี่นาที อันนี้ก็ตั้งไปตามชอบเลยค่ะ ถ้าเครื่องคอมฯช้าๆ เน็ทช้าๆบุกไม่แนะนำให้ตั้งถี่มาก ทุกๆ 15 นาทีก็พอค่ะ ถ้าเครื่องแรงเน็ทแรง ตั้งไปเลยค่ะ ทุก 3 นาที 5 นาที .. ไม่ว่ากัน ;)
  • Check for new articles at startup : ให้เช็คเว็บสำหรับอัพเดททันทีที่เปิดโปรแกรมเลยไหม อันนี้แนะนำให้ติ๊กไปเลยค่ะ
  • By default, show the article summary instead of loading the whole web page : บางบล็อกจะมี option ให้แสดงบทความแบบย่อๆ (บางบล็อกก็ไม่มี) สำหรับคนที่เน็ทช้า หรือคนที่ต้องการจะเช็คข่าวแค่คร่าวๆ (จะอ่านเต็มก็กดลิ้งค์ไปอ่านที่เว็บโดยตรง) บุกแนะนำว่า ไม่ต้องติ๊กก็ได้ค่ะ เพราะอ่านย่อๆก็อ่านที่หัวข้อข่าวก็ได้ เวลาคลิกหัวข้อข่าว เราก็อยากอ่านข่าวเต็มๆเพราะสนใจในหัวข้ออยู่แล้ว

หลังจากกำหนดค่าต่างๆทั้งสามอย่างข้างบนนี่เรียบร้อยแล้ว ก็กดปุ่ม “Manage Subscriptions…” เพื่อทำการ “สมัคร” รับข่าวค่ะ (( ใกล้ความจริงแร้ววว ))

5. มาถึงขั้นสำคัญแล้วค่ะ การสมัครรับ Feeds หลังจากกดปุ่ม “Manage Subscriptions…” ไปแล้ว โปรแกรมก็จะขึ้นหน้าต่างนี้มาให้เราค่ะ

RSS Subscription

มาถึงตรงนี้บางคนอาจจะสังเกตเห็นว่า เอ๊ะ ทำไมหน้าต่างนี้ของบุกถึงมีปุ่มขึ้นมาพิเศษสองอันที่ (ปุ่ม Import / Export OPML…) ไม่เห็นจะมีในหน้าต่างของเพื่อนๆเลยล่ะ อันนี้ก็เพราะว่าบุกลง patch พิเศษที่ทำให้มีปุ่มพิเศษสองปุ่มนี้เพิ่มขึ้นมาน่ะค่ะ ข้อดีของการลง patch นี้ก็คือทำให้เราสามารถ save (export) รายการเว็บที่เราสมัครไว้ไปใช้กับโปรแกรมอ่านข่าวตัวอื่นๆ (โดยการ import) ได้ ไม่ต้องมานั่ง add ทีละรายการอย่างที่เรากำลังจะทำต่อไปนี้อีกหลายๆรอบน่ะค่ะ ถ้าเพื่อนๆสนใจจะลง ก็ทำตามวิธีทำในเว็บที่บุกได้ลิ้งค์แล้วกันนะคะ บุกขอไม่เขียนถึง

กลับเข้ามาเรื่องการสมัครรับข่าวต่อ .. พอกดปุ่ม Add หน้าต่างนี้ก็จะขึ้นมานะคะ

Adding Feed

เราก็ก๊อบเอาลิ้งค์ RSS|Atom feeds จากเว็บที่ต้องการสมัครมาลงในช่อง Feed URL แล้วก็กด OK แค่นี้ก็เรียบร้อยแล้วค่ะ จะสมัครกี่อันก็ทำซ้ำกันแบบเดิมนี่แหละ

เพื่อนๆอาจจะสงสัยว่า ไอ้เจ้า Feed URL นี่เราจะไปหามาได้จากไหนล่ะ? ลองย้อนกลับไปดูรูปบนสุดที่มี CNN / Google News อีกทีนะคะ ลิ้งค์ Feed นี่มันมักจะมาในรูปแบบที่บุกยกตัวอย่างมาให้ดูในรูปนี้นั่นแหละค่ะ บางทีก็เป็นไอค่อน RSS, Atom, XML หรือบางที่ก็เขียนว่า Syndicate our site, Subscribe to our feed ไม่พ้นจากนี้ไปเท่าไหร่

ยกตัวอย่างเช่นบล็อกของบุกอันนี้ (อะแฮ่ม .. โคดสะนา) ลิ้งค์สำหรับ RSS Feed จะอยู่ทางด้านขวาล่างของหน้าจอ เราก็เอาลูกศรเม้าส์ไปจ่อ คลิกเม้าส์ปุ่มขวา (คนใช้แม็คก็กดปุ่มที่มีอยู่ปุ่มเดียวไปนะคะ แหะๆ) เพื่อเรียก context menu ขึ้นมา จากนั้นก็เลือก Copy Link Location อย่างในภาพนะคะ หลายคนดูรูปตัวอย่างอันนี้แล้วเกาหัวแกร่กๆ พอดีบุกใช้ Mozilla Firefox ท่องเว็บน่ะค่ะ :P เมนูอะไรอาจจะไม่ตรงกับของ IE เอาเป็นที่เข้าใจตรงกันแล้วกันนะคะว่า ก๊อบลิ้งค์มาลงจากตรงนี้

Copy RSS Feed URL

พอก๊อบลิ้งค์มาเสร็จ ก็ paste ใส่ในช่อง Feed URL แล้วกด OK

Add Feed

เรียบร้อย! หน้าต่าง RSS Subscriptions ของเราตอนนี้ก็จะสมัครรับ Feed ไปเรียบร้อยแล้ว 1 อัน :)

Feed added

ที่หน้าหลักของโปรแกรมก็จะมีขึ้นเป็น folder ของบล็อกที่เราสมัคร (ในที่นี้ = Chow Crave) ขึ้นมาทางด้านซ้ายมือใต้ News & Blogs

Thunderbird - main screen

ด้านขวาบนก็จะเป็นรายการบทความของบล็อกที่เมื่อเราคลิก จะโปรแกรมจะโหลดบทความนั้นๆมาแสดงในส่วนขวาล่างอย่างในรูปค่ะ

จบแล้วค่ะ วิธีลงและติดตั้งโปรแกรมสำหรับอ่านบล็อก :) ไม่ยากเกินความสามารถของเราๆเลย ใช่ไหมคะ? สำหรับคนที่ไม่ต้องการติดตั้งโปรแกรม มันก็มีบริการทางเว็บที่สามารถใช้สมัครและเช็คอัพเดทของเว็บต่างๆได้ให้เลือกใช้หลายที่ อย่างเช่น Bloglines ซึ่งมีข้อได้เปรียบคือเราสามารถล็อคเข้าไปอ่านจากคอมเครื่องไหนก็ได้ โดยส่วนตัวแล้วบุกชอบใช้ Thunderbird เช็คข่าวมากกว่า เพราะยังไงๆก็เปิดไว้เช็คเมล์อยู่แล้ว ไม่ต้องไปเปลืองหน้าต่าง browser อีกอัน สำหรับ Bloglines ก็เก็บไว้ใช้สำรองยามเดินทางต่างถิ่นที่แบกคอมตัวเองไปด้วยไม่ได้ ก็ค่อยเช็คข่าวจาก Bloglines เอา :)

น่าเสียดายที่บล็อกที่พันทิปไม่มีบริการ RSS feed (หรือมี/มีทางทำได้แต่บุกไม่ทราบก็เป็นได้) ซึ่งเป็นหนึ่งในหลายๆเหตุผลที่บุกเลือกทำบล็อกที่อื่น แล้วลิ้งค์ไปที่หน้าบล็อกแก๊งพันทิปของบุกแทน

หวังว่าที่บุกเขียนๆมาคงเป็นประโยชน์สำหรับคนที่สนใจบ้างนะคะ :)

3 Comments »

The URI to TrackBack this entry is: http://bmb.blogsome.com/2005/08/17/rss/trackback/

  1. มาอ่านวิธีลงthunderbird จ้า :D

    Comment by p!m — January 11, 2006 @ 6:20 pm

  2. มีประโยชน์มากๆเลยพี่บุก
    ในที่สุดก็รับfeedได้แล้ว โอเย
    ขอบคุณนะคะ =)

    Comment by อาย — January 26, 2006 @ 6:43 am

  3. บุกจ๊ะ ผ่านไปเป็นเวลากว่าสองปีครึ่งแล้ว ในที่สุด เราก็ได้ติดตั้ง Thunderbird เรียบร้อย รร. บุก ตะกี้นี้เองจ่ะ ขอบใจมากนะจ๊ะ

    Comment by P!M — January 13, 2008 @ 6:55 am

RSS feed for comments on this post.

Leave a comment

Line and paragraph breaks automatic, e-mail address never displayed, HTML allowed: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<code> <em> <i> <strike> <strong>